网站一年续费多少钱网站备案号信息修改
2026/1/13 14:38:48 网站建设 项目流程
网站一年续费多少钱,网站备案号信息修改,注册个公司大概要多少钱,wordpress批量提交rss第一章#xff1a;Open-AutoGLM插件实战指南#xff1a;3步实现零代码谷歌浏览器自动化准备工作#xff1a;安装与启用插件 在开始自动化任务前#xff0c;需确保已正确安装 Open-AutoGLM 浏览器插件。访问 Chrome 网上应用店#xff0c;搜索“Open-AutoGLM”并点击“添加…第一章Open-AutoGLM插件实战指南3步实现零代码谷歌浏览器自动化准备工作安装与启用插件在开始自动化任务前需确保已正确安装 Open-AutoGLM 浏览器插件。访问 Chrome 网上应用店搜索“Open-AutoGLM”并点击“添加至 Chrome”。安装完成后浏览器右上角将出现插件图标点击即可激活面板。配置自动化流程无需编写任何代码通过可视化界面即可定义操作流程。点击插件图标后在弹出的控制台中选择“新建任务”随后可通过以下步骤构建自动化逻辑选择目标网站输入 URL 并加载页面使用鼠标点击元素以录制交互动作如填写表单、点击按钮设置触发条件例如“页面加载完成时自动执行”执行与调试任务任务保存后可随时手动运行或设定定时执行。插件会在后台控制浏览器模拟用户行为。若操作失败日志面板将显示详细错误信息包括元素未找到、超时等问题。// 示例Open-AutoGLM 导出的可读任务脚本仅供查看 { taskName: 自动登录示例, steps: [ { action: navigate, url: https://example.com/login }, { action: type, selector: #username, value: user123 }, { action: click, selector: #submit-btn } ], trigger: manual } // 注此脚本由插件自动生成用户无需手动编辑功能是否支持说明元素自动识别✅基于 DOM 分析与 AI 推理定位元素跨页面流程✅支持多跳转场景的连续操作数据导出❌当前版本暂不支持结构化数据提取graph TD A[启动插件] -- B{选择任务类型} B -- C[录制新任务] B -- D[运行已有任务] C -- E[执行交互操作] E -- F[保存流程] D -- G[后台自动执行]第二章Open-AutoGLM核心功能解析与环境准备2.1 Open-AutoGLM架构设计与技术原理Open-AutoGLM采用分层解耦的微服务架构旨在实现大语言模型的自动化推理优化与动态调度。系统核心由任务编排引擎、自适应推理模块和反馈驱动器三部分构成。任务编排机制通过DAG有向无环图定义推理流程支持多模型串联与条件分支{ task_id: t-2024-glm, nodes: [ { type: preprocess, service: nlu-service }, { type: reasoning, service: glm-infer, adaptive: true } ], feedback_loop: { enabled: true, interval_ms: 500 } }上述配置表明系统在执行自然语言理解后调用具备自适应能力的GLM推理服务并启用每500毫秒一次的反馈校准。动态推理优化系统基于负载与延迟指标动态调整模型参数关键策略如下根据请求QPS自动切换稠密/稀疏注意力模式利用历史响应时间预测最优batch size通过轻量探针实时检测GPU显存压力2.2 插件安装与浏览器兼容性配置在现代Web开发中插件的正确安装与浏览器兼容性配置是确保功能稳定运行的关键环节。不同浏览器对API的支持存在差异需通过标准化配置降低兼容风险。主流浏览器支持矩阵浏览器支持版本备注Chrome≥90完全支持ES模块Firefox≥88需启用实验性功能Safari≥15部分API需前缀插件安装示例npmnpm install plugin/core --save-dev # 安装核心插件并添加至开发依赖该命令将插件安装到项目本地--save-dev确保其仅在开发环境引入避免生产包体积膨胀。2.3 API密钥申请与身份认证流程在接入第三方服务前开发者需完成API密钥的申请与身份认证。通常流程始于在平台控制台注册应用并填写回调地址、应用类型等基本信息。申请流程步骤登录开放平台账户进入“开发者中心”创建新项目提交应用名称、域名及使用场景系统生成AppID与AppSecret认证方式示例多数API采用OAuth 2.0或HMAC-SHA256签名机制。以下为请求头中携带密钥的常见方式GET /api/v1/data HTTP/1.1 Host: api.example.com Authorization: Bearer e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9... X-API-Key: 7f3e8a1d-2c4b-4f0c-9d5a-3c7b8a2f1e0d其中Authorization字段用于传递JWT令牌实现用户级权限控制X-API-Key则标识应用身份常用于频率限制与调用追踪。安全建议私钥不得硬编码于前端代码建议使用环境变量存储敏感信息定期轮换密钥以降低泄露风险2.4 自动化任务执行模式详解自动化任务执行模式是现代运维体系中的核心机制支持定时触发、事件驱动和条件判断等多种执行方式。执行模式类型定时执行基于 Cron 表达式周期性运行任务事件驱动响应系统告警、代码提交等外部事件条件触发满足特定阈值或状态时自动激活代码示例Cron 定时任务配置schedule: cron: 0 2 * * * # 每日凌晨2点执行 timezone: Asia/Shanghai command: /opt/scripts/backup.sh上述配置表示在指定时区每天凌晨2点执行备份脚本cron 字段遵循标准五字段格式分别对应分钟、小时、日、月、星期。执行优先级对比模式响应速度资源消耗适用场景定时执行中低周期性维护事件驱动高中实时处理2.5 安全机制与隐私保护策略端到端加密通信为保障数据传输安全系统采用基于TLS 1.3的端到端加密机制。所有客户端与服务端之间的通信均通过ECDHE密钥交换算法实现前向保密。// 启用TLS 1.3的服务器配置示例 tlsConfig : tls.Config{ MinVersion: tls.VersionTLS13, CipherSuites: []uint16{ tls.TLS_AES_128_GCM_SHA256, tls.TLS_AES_256_GCM_SHA384, }, }上述代码配置强制使用TLS 1.3协议并限定高强度加密套件防止降级攻击。MinVersion设置确保不接受低版本易受攻击的TLS连接。用户数据访问控制采用基于角色的访问控制RBAC模型结合OAuth 2.0令牌验证用户权限。用户请求需携带JWT令牌网关层验证签名与过期时间微服务根据scope字段授权操作第三章零代码自动化流程构建实践3.1 可视化操作录制与脚本生成操作行为捕获机制系统通过监听页面DOM事件如点击、输入、滚动实现用户操作的可视化录制。每个动作被序列化为结构化指令包含元素选择器、操作类型和参数值。启动录制注入代理脚本监听用户交互事件捕获记录目标元素与操作上下文脚本生成将行为流转换为可执行代码自动化脚本输出示例// 模拟表单填写与提交 await page.click(#login-btn); await page.type(#username, admin); await page.type(#password, 123456); await page.click(#submit);上述Puppeteer代码由录制流程自动生成。page对象代表浏览器页面实例click()触发元素点击type()模拟逐字符输入。选择器采用CSS标准确保回放时精准定位。该机制大幅降低自动化测试脚本编写门槛提升开发效率。3.2 页面元素智能识别与定位技术现代自动化测试与爬虫系统依赖于精准的页面元素识别与定位能力。传统方式多采用静态选择器如ID、class或XPath但在动态渲染页面中稳定性差。基于语义特征的元素定位通过分析文本内容、标签结构与上下文关系构建元素的语义指纹。例如使用CSS选择器结合文本匹配提升定位鲁棒性document.evaluate( //button[contains(text(), 登录)], document.body );该XPath表达式通过文本语义定位按钮避免因class变动导致的识别失败适用于UI频繁迭代的场景。多模态融合识别引入视觉与DOM树联合分析机制利用图像特征辅助定位难以通过代码捕捉的元素。如下表格对比主流定位方式方法准确率适应动态页面CSS选择器78%弱XPath85%中语义视觉融合96%强3.3 条件判断与循环逻辑的无代码实现在低代码平台中条件判断与循环逻辑可通过可视化规则引擎实现无需编写传统代码。通过拖拽式配置用户可定义业务流程中的分支路径与重复执行逻辑。可视化条件配置平台提供图形化条件设置面板支持设置“如果...则...否则”结构。例如根据用户角色决定数据可见性条件用户角色 “管理员”动作显示全部数据否则仅显示个人数据循环逻辑建模对于批量处理场景如逐条审批报销单系统通过“遍历集合”组件实现循环。配置如下{ action: iterate, source: expenseReports, each: { approve: true, notify: submitter } }该配置表示对每一份报销单自动执行审批并通知提交人逻辑清晰且易于维护。第四章典型应用场景实战演练4.1 跨页面数据抓取与结构化输出在构建大规模数据采集系统时跨页面数据抓取是实现信息聚合的关键环节。通过识别多个页面间的关联路径可自动化遍历目标站点并提取分散内容。动态导航与上下文保持使用 Puppeteer 或 Playwright 可维护浏览器上下文实现登录态保持与页面跳转追踪。以下为基于 Node.js 的示例const puppeteer require(puppeteer); (async () { const browser await puppeteer.launch(); const page await browser.newPage(); await page.goto(https://example.com/list); const links await page.$$eval(a.detail-link, as as.map(a a.href)); const results []; for (let url of links) { await page.goto(url); const data await page.evaluate(() ({ title: document.querySelector(h1).innerText, price: document.querySelector(.price).textContent })); results.push(data); } await browser.close(); })();该脚本首先获取列表页中所有详情链接逐个访问并结构化提取标题与价格字段最终整合为统一数据集。结构化输出规范建议采用 JSON Schema 定义输出格式确保字段一致性。例如字段名类型说明titlestring商品名称pricenumber价格单位元4.2 自动表单填写与批量提交任务在现代Web自动化场景中自动表单填写与批量提交是提升效率的关键环节。通过脚本模拟用户输入行为可显著减少重复性操作。核心技术实现使用Puppeteer等无头浏览器工具可精准控制页面元素的填充与提交// 启动浏览器并打开目标页面 const browser await puppeteer.launch({ headless: false }); const page await browser.newPage(); await page.goto(https://example.com/form); // 填写表单字段 await page.type(#username, testuser); await page.select(#department, engineering); await page.click(#submit-btn); // 提交表单上述代码展示了基本的表单交互流程定位输入框、填入值、触发提交动作。page.type() 模拟真实键盘输入兼容前端验证逻辑。批量处理策略读取CSV或JSON数据源作为输入集合循环执行表单填写逻辑每次提交后重置页面状态加入延迟机制避免请求过于频繁结合异常重试机制确保高可靠性批量操作。4.3 定时任务设置与云端调度运行在现代云原生架构中定时任务的自动化调度是保障数据处理与服务同步的关键环节。通过结合 Kubernetes CronJob 与云端函数服务可实现高可用、弹性伸缩的任务执行。使用 Kubernetes CronJob 配置定时任务apiVersion: batch/v1 kind: CronJob metadata: name:>// 示例Kafka 消费者处理用户数据同步 func consumeUserEvent(msg *kafka.Message) { var user User json.Unmarshal(msg.Value, user) // 同步至目标系统API syncToExternalSystem(user.ID, user.Email) }该逻辑监听用户变更事件解析后调用外部系统REST接口确保数据实时更新。重试机制与死信队列保障可靠性。集成方式对比方式实时性复杂度适用场景API轮询低低小规模静态数据Webhook推送高中事件驱动架构CDC 消息队列高高大规模实时同步第五章未来演进方向与生态扩展设想服务网格的深度集成随着微服务架构的普及将配置中心与服务网格如 Istio深度融合成为趋势。通过 Envoy 的 xDS 协议动态推送配置可实现毫秒级配置更新。例如在 Go 控制平面中注册资源配置func registerConfigDiscoveryService(s *grpc.Server) { discovery.RegisterAggregatedDiscoveryServiceServer(s, ConfigADS{ ConfigStore: config.NewStore(), }) }该模式已在某金融企业落地支撑日均 200 万次配置变更。多运行时配置统一管理现代应用常混合使用 Kubernetes、Serverless 与边缘节点。构建统一配置平面需支持多环境抽象。典型部署结构如下运行时类型同步机制延迟要求KubernetesWatch Informer1sAWS LambdaPolling (30s)45s边缘 IoTMQTT Delta5s基于策略的自动化治理通过引入 Open Policy AgentOPA可在配置写入前执行策略校验。常见策略包括禁止在生产环境开启调试日志数据库连接池最大值不得超过 100敏感字段必须加密存储灰度配置变更需关联发布单号配置生命周期流程图开发提交 → OPA 策略校验 → 审计日志记录 → 差异比对 → 灰度推送 → 全量生效

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询